At X10 we are always trying to figure out unique ways to simplify our daily lives. I have to say I’m quite pleased with the latest thing our guys have come up with. I blurred out their faces as to protect their identities. I caught them hooking up an ActiveEye Motion Sensor to the traffic signal outside our building. They must have used a lamp module to get the signal to change, but whatever they did it works. It’s been up there for about a week now and I have yet to sit at that light for longer than it takes to slow my car down. I’m telling you it’s the fastest changing light I’ve seen. It sure makes getting to lunch and home a lot speedier. It also makes me wonder what other uses there are for our motion sensor lighting kits. I’m sure I can come up with something cool at my house, so I’ll let you know. Has anyone else come up with any creative ideas for motion sensors?
